A casino is a facility that offers various forms of gambling, entertainment, and leisure activities, often combined with hospitality services such as dining and betninja review accommodation. The term “casino” is derived from the Italian word “casa,” meaning “house,” and historically referred to a small villa or summerhouse. Over time, the meaning has evolved to represent establishments where gambling activities are conducted, providing a vibrant atmosphere for players and visitors alike.
Casinos typically feature a wide array of gaming options, including table games, slot machines, and electronic gaming devices. Table games such as poker, blackjack, roulette, and craps are popular choices that require skill, strategy, and sometimes luck. Slot machines, on the other hand, are often considered the most accessible form of gambling, attracting players with their colorful displays and enticing themes. Electronic gaming machines have also gained popularity, offering a modern twist on traditional gambling experiences.
In addition to gaming, many casinos offer a range of entertainment options, including live performances, concerts, and shows. These events can vary from musical acts to theatrical performances, providing guests with opportunities to enjoy entertainment beyond gambling. Furthermore, casinos often feature restaurants, bars, and lounges, enhancing the overall experience for visitors. Some establishments may even include luxury hotels, spas, and shopping areas, creating an all-encompassing leisure destination.
Casinos are typically located in areas where tourism is prevalent, such as Las Vegas, Monte Carlo, and Macau. The gambling industry plays a significant role in the economy of these locations, generating substantial revenue through gaming taxes and attracting millions of visitors each year. As a result, many cities have embraced casinos as a means of boosting their local economies and promoting tourism.
The regulation of casinos varies by country and region, with many jurisdictions implementing strict laws to ensure fair play and protect consumers. Licensing requirements, age restrictions, and responsible gambling initiatives are common regulations aimed at mitigating the risks associated with gambling. Many casinos also offer resources for players who may be struggling with gambling addiction, including support groups and self-exclusion programs.
While casinos can provide entertainment and excitement, it is essential for players to approach gambling responsibly. Understanding the odds, setting limits, and recognizing the signs of problem gambling are crucial aspects of enjoying the casino experience. Players should be aware that while winning is possible, the odds are often in favor of the house, making it important to gamble within one’s means.
